7440-69-9 Synthesis and characterization of Bi nanorods and superconducting NiBi particles

Bi nanorods and NiBi particles were prepared using a simple hydrothermal reduction method at moderate temperatures of 150 °C. Transmission electron microscopy (TEM) reveals pure Bi nanorods with diameters of about 50 nm and superconducting NiBi particles.
